THE ROLE:

This dynamic role would suit a fun loving, people person, who is passionate about the power of climbing, social inclusion and community development.

This newly created role will involve co-ordinating and delivering an exciting programme of social & climbing events for our diverse community. The successful candidate will have the creative autonomy to propose ideas which add value to our customer experience, drive customer engagement and promote a culture of fun and inspiration.

As Community & Events Manager, you will also have a dedicated focus on engaging and retaining customers, as well as developing 'routes into climbing' with the wider community through outreach work with under represented groups.
